Dear all,
yesterday I reported on GitHub that the regression tests of KEGGREST
fail because the KEGGREST:::.get.tmp.url function can not parse
www.kegg.jp pages anymore.
https://github.com/Bioconductor/KEGGREST/issues/21
This is a problem in Debian because 1) we do not allow the Bioconductor
packages that we redistribute to fail their tests and 2) the
reverse-dependency chain of KEGGREST is heavy.
KEGGREST <- AnnotationDbi <- GenomicFeatures <- lots of other packages
I am not familiar with KEGG enough to grasp what KEGGREST:::.get.tmp.url
was looking for. But I was wondering if this bug would be a low-hanging
fruit for somebody else in this list?
